Pré. | Proc. |
Migration des connexions OLEDB/ODBC vers Native
Avec l'introduction des connexions natives dans Pro Cloud Server v5, Sparx Systems suggère que tous les gestionnaires de bases de données définis avec des pilotes OLE/DB ou ODBC soient remplacés par des connexions natives dès que possible.
À ce stade, le processus de migration est un processus manuel.
Prérequis
- Un serveur de base de données SGBD
- Une base de données définie dans le serveur de base de données avec les définitions tableau nécessaires
- Vous connaissez les informations d'identification de l'utilisateur de la base de données qui disposent des autorisations d'accès appropriées, telles que SELECT, UPDATE, INSERT, EXECUTE et DELETE
Les connexions natives offrent ces avantages
- Pas besoin d'installer de pilotes tiers (dans la plupart des cas)
- Pas besoin de créer de DSN ODBC
- Les chaînes de connexion PCS contiennent tous les détails de connexion nécessaires
- Les chaînes de connexion natives fonctionnent pour les architectures 32 et 64 bits
Migration des connexions basées sur OLE/DB
Une string de connexion OLE/DB doit contenir tous les détails nécessaires, par conséquent le processus de migration comprend les étapes suivantes :
- Ouvrez le client de configuration Pro Cloud Server Sparx Systems Pro.
- Sélectionnez le gestionnaire de base de données basé sur OLE/DB dans la liste.
- Cliquez sur le bouton Modifier pour révision les détails de connexion du gestionnaire de base de données.
- Prenez note de tous les paramètres sur le Configurer l'écran du gestionnaire de base de données, ainsi que ceux étendus pour Exécuter la génération de graphiques planifiée et Générer périodiquement des images Diagramme pour WebEA et Prolaborate .
- note tous les paramètres de la base de données (tels que définis dans la string de connexion). C'est-à-dire « Nom du serveur », « Port », « Nom de la base de données » et « Utilisateur ». Le mot de passe de l'utilisateur de la base de données sera crypté, il est donc attendu qu'une personne de votre organisation connaisse le mot de passe de l'utilisateur de la base de données donné.
- Modifiez la valeur « Alias » ; nous vous suggérons d'ajouter le texte « (oledb) » à la fin.
- Fermez le Configurer l'écran du gestionnaire de base de données.
- Cliquez sur le bouton Ajouter dans l'onglet « Gestionnaires de bases de données », cela devrait afficher l'écran Ajouter un gestionnaire de bases de données (natif).
- Entrez la valeur d'alias pour qu'elle soit celle du gestionnaire de base de données d'origine.
- Saisissez les détails de la base de données notés aux étapes 5 et 6.
- Cliquez sur le bouton Test pour confirmer qu'une connexion peut être établie.
- Cliquez sur le bouton OK pour enregistrer la connexion.
- Modifiez le gestionnaire de base de données que vous avez créé précédemment et ajustez tous les paramètres pour qu'ils correspondent à ceux du gestionnaire de base de données d'origine.
- Test que vos clients peuvent accéder au référentiel (en utilisant l'« Alias » d'origine).
- Une fois que tout est confirmé comme fonctionnant comme prévu, le gestionnaire de base de données renommé peut être supprimé.
Migration des connexions basées sur ODBC
Une string de connexion OLE/DB doit contenir tous les détails nécessaires, par conséquent le processus de migration comprend les étapes suivantes :
- Ouvrez le client de configuration Pro Cloud Server Sparx Systems Pro.
- Sélectionnez le gestionnaire de base de données basé sur ODBC dans la liste.
- Cliquez sur le bouton Modifier pour révision les détails de connexion du gestionnaire de base de données.
- Prenez note de tous les paramètres sur l'écran Configurer le gestionnaire de base de données, ainsi que ceux étendus pour « Exécuter la génération de graphiques programmée » et « Générer périodiquement des images Diagramme pour WebEA et Prolaborate ».
- Prenez note du DSN ODBC.
- Ouvrez l’écran Administration de la source de données ODBC, recherchez le DSN ODBC et cliquez sur le bouton Configurer.
- note tous les paramètres de base de données enregistrés dans le DSN. C'est-à-dire le nom du serveur, le port, le nom de la base de données et l'utilisateur. Le mot de passe de l'utilisateur de la base de données sera masqué, il est donc normal qu'une personne de votre organisation connaisse le mot de passe de l'utilisateur de la base de données concerné.
- Modifiez la valeur « Alias » ; nous suggérons d'ajouter le texte « (odbc) » à la fin, ce qui renommera le gestionnaire de base de données d'origine en quelque chose d'autre.
- Fermer le Configurer l'écran du gestionnaire de base de données.
- Cliquez sur le bouton Ajouter dans l'onglet « Gestionnaires de bases de données », cela devrait afficher l'écran Ajouter un gestionnaire de bases de données (natif).
- Type la valeur « Alias », celle-ci étant la même que pour le gestionnaire de base de données d'origine.
- Saisissez les détails de la base de données que vous avez notés à l’étape 7.
- Cliquez sur le bouton Test pour confirmer qu'une connexion peut être établie.
- Cliquez sur le bouton OK pour enregistrer la connexion.
- Modifiez le gestionnaire de base de données que vous avez créé à l’étape 10 et ajustez tous les paramètres pour qu’ils correspondent à ceux du gestionnaire de base de données d’origine.
- Test que vos clients peuvent accéder au référentiel (en utilisant l'alias d'origine).
- Une fois que tout est confirmé comme fonctionnant comme prévu, le gestionnaire de base de données renommé peut être supprimé.